Whether you are using Affymetrix® GeneChips®, Illumina® BeadChips or Agilent® Microarrays to make your next discovery: You have to invest a lot in sample preparation for your expression studies, instead of having the time to focus on your results. This procedure is also very error-prone, due to the large number of steps involved. As a solution to this problem, HAMILTON now offers an automated system based on their Microlab STAR.

Together with our partners Nestlé Research Center (NRC) and Agendia, Hamilton have developed a complete solution for this kind of sample preparation starting from tissue (as an alternative protocols are available for cells, yeast or bacteria) and ending with labelled cRNA targets ready for hybridisation. All additional equipment, like Thermocycler and Microplate Reader is fully integrated by an internal robotic hand called iSWAP. The complete protocol is divided into three methods (see Fig.): Excel worklists with samples to process are created in the beginning of method 1 and can be reused for running later methods. After total RNA normalization in method 1 and cRNA normalization in method 3, a microtiter plate with small aliquots of the samples is prepared by the system to be used in offline quality analysis (e.g. on a Bioanalyzer).

Microplate readers are generally distinguished by their mode of detection. Types include absorbance, luminescence, fluorescence intensity, fluorescence polarization, TRF / FRET and multimode microplate readers. Microplate readers deliver a high throughput of samples by reading multiple wells simultaneously, with the 96-well format the most commonly used. As a result, microplate readers are often used in the drug discovery, bioassays, research and pharmaceutical industries for screening applications. Microplate loading can also be automated, with robotic microplate stackers to increase throughput.
